A vacancy has arisen with Highland Reserve Forces’ and Cadets’ Association (HRFCA) for a Caretaker at the Cadet Training Centre at Boddam, Aberdeenshire.
The position is full-time, 37 hours per week, including some weekend work.
Previous military service would be an advantage, but is not essential. Applicants should reside within easy commuting distance of Boddam.
This is a Crown Servant (Civil Servant Band SZ2 equivalent) and the salary is £24,350. The successful candidate will be eligible to join the Council of RFCA’s Pension Scheme which operates on a Career Average Revalued Earnings (CARE) basis and has a personal contribution for members of 5% of pensionable earnings. Annual leave, excluding Public Holidays, is 25 days per year, rising to 30 days after five years’ service; previous public sector employment may count towards qualifying years’ service. The successful applicant will undergo a six-month probationary period.
